AYUSH and CDSCO regulations require documented safety testing before market launch. Our NABL-accredited reports are accepted by the Ministry of AYUSH, state drug controllers, and international importers.
Reports accepted by AYUSH Ministry, CDSCO, and state drug licensing authorities for product registration and import/export.
Heavy metals, aflatoxins, and pesticide residues in herbal raw materials pose serious health risks — testing confirms safe limits per API/IP standards.
Most Ayurvedic safety tests completed in 5–10 working days. Priority TAT available for registration deadlines and export shipments.
